I always look to Pantone to guide me in my research and as usual I was not disappointed.

The fall/winter picks are an array of visually appealing colors. They blend well in patterns and prints but can also stand alone.

HOW TO wearing and or blend new colors into your wardrobe . Choose a solid as your base…such as the bright poppy for fall. Consider pairing it in small doses (say jewelry) or go bold as in a sweater. Now, add another of the fall colors…say an almond buff colored pant. You may add more color or stop here. I would add a scarf in these two colors to wear at my neck. You’ve instantly created a fresh look for fall.
If you are not quite that daring in your wardrobe, I recommend choosing just one of these colors to add a statement such as ceylon yellow or meerkat colored bag.

Why not try wearing martini olive as a neutral like this great top from Liligal.com? Wear it with dark washed denim and your favorite brown boots. Add pops of color via accessories in russet orange and limelight. Very earthy.
Trendy girls will go wild and add pops of color to their wardrobes like a pair of russet orange slacks. The key here is to pair it with something to tone it down like a graphic tee for hanging out with friends.
If you like to play around with colors but don’t want to commit to them, a scarf in fall’s colors are always a safe bet. Patterns in paisley, floral, and strips are always spot on.
